NodeServicesOptions クラス

定義

注意事項

Use Microsoft.AspNetCore.SpaServices.Extensions

インスタンスの構成 INodeServices に使用されるオプションについて説明します。

public ref class NodeServicesOptions
public class NodeServicesOptions
[System.Obsolete("Use Microsoft.AspNetCore.SpaServices.Extensions")]
public class NodeServicesOptions
type NodeServicesOptions = class
[<System.Obsolete("Use Microsoft.AspNetCore.SpaServices.Extensions")>]
type NodeServicesOptions = class
Public Class NodeServicesOptions
継承
NodeServicesOptions
属性

コンストラクター

NodeServicesOptions(IServiceProvider)
古い.

NodeServicesOptions の新しいインスタンスを作成します。

プロパティ

ApplicationStoppingToken
古い.

ホスト アプリケーションがいつ停止しているのかを示すトークン。

DebuggingPort
古い.

が true の場合 LaunchWithDebugging 、Node.js インスタンスはこのポートで V8 デバッガー接続をリッスンします。

EnvironmentVariables
古い.

設定されている場合は、指定した環境変数を使用して Node.js インスタンスを開始します。

InvocationTimeoutMilliseconds
古い.

RPC 呼び出しが返されるまで .NET コードが待機する最大時間 (ミリ秒単位) Node.js 指定します。

LaunchWithDebugging
古い.

true の場合、Node.js インスタンスは受信 V8 デバッガー接続を受け入れます (例: node-inspector)。

NodeInstanceFactory
古い.

Node.js インスタンスを構築する方法を指定します。 は INodeInstance 、インスタンスの起動と通信方法 Node.js 関するすべての詳細をカプセル化します。 前のインスタンスが終了した場合 (ソース ファイルが変更されたためなど)、新 INodeInstance しい が自動的に作成されます。

NodeInstanceOutputLogger
古い.

Node.js インスタンスの stdout/stderr は、この ILoggerにリダイレクトされます。

ProjectPath
古い.

設定されている場合は、アプリケーションのルートへのパスをオーバーライドします。 このパスは、プロジェクトを基準に Node.js モジュールを検索するときに使用されます。

WatchFileExtensions
古い.

設定すると、プロジェクト内のディスク上の一致するファイルが変更されたときに、Node.js インスタンスが再起動されます。

拡張メソッド

UseHttpHosting(NodeServicesOptions)
古い.

アウトプロセス Node.js INodeServices インスタンスを使用し、HTTP 経由で RPC 呼び出しを実行するようにサービスを構成します。

適用対象